  • Patent number: 5635775
    Abstract: An electro-magnetic interference suppressor includes a segmented array of ceramic feed-through capacitors, and a conductive fence which is attached to the capacitor array about its periphery. The fence is attached to a ground of a printed circuit board such that a generally planar surface of the segmented array lies adjacent to a planar surface of the printed circuit board. The suppressor provides an effective filter for eliminating unwanted noise occurring in electronic circuitry. The fence, in one embodiment, is surface mounted and soldered to a surface ground pad of the printed circuit board. In another embodiment, the fence includes a ground pin which extends into printed circuit board for contact with the circuit board ground. The ground pin may be soldered in place or may include a compliant section for press-fit reception within a through-hole.
